iKnow Launches Courses in Chinese Media - 0 views

  •  
    Series of 5 courses on 1220 vocabulary words important for reading newspapers and other media in China. Includes options for studying with traditional, simplified or Pinyin characters.

Call for Papers - Beyond the Language Classroom « Innovation in Teaching - 0 views

  •  
    We are inviting contributions to an edited book, to be published by a major international publisher, on the topic of language learning and teaching beyond the classroom. The aim of the book is to provide an account of the range of settings and types of learning and teaching beyond the classroom and to develop a broad theoretical understanding of this area of research and practice.

Edmodo 2.0 Launch - 0 views

  •  
    Edmodo is a private microblogging platform that teachers and students can use to send notes, links, files, alerts, assignments, and events to each other. Teachers sign up for accounts, and then create groups. Each group has a unique code which is distributed by the teacher to the class. Students then sign up (no email address required) and join the group using the code.
